Transaction 37ece8dcd9397a64a1af8808286d062b0672152073c2fcc830c00a1529f21d40
1 Input
2 Outputs
- 37ece8dcd9397a64a1af8808286d062b0672152073c2fcc830c00a1529f21d40:0
- 37ece8dcd9397a64a1af8808286d062b0672152073c2fcc830c00a1529f21d40:1
value 9212529
address 114PWrPFE8kMyrXW3jYFMZM83f7RC2Y7zb
value 1613820
address 17Crcgvi1X9Vt8F4qgWV2VahN1xwVwmvDA